Chapter One: "Here Once Lay the Body of the Great Alexander": From the Poetic Image of Alexandria to Poetic Dwelling
Ali Reza Shahbazin
Chapter Two: Faces of the Goddess: Gnostic Div(a)nity in Lawrence Durrell and Anatole France
David Melville Wingrove
Chapter Three: Lawrence Durrell and Georges Bataille: Brothers in Heresy
Luca Barbaglia and Bartolo Casiraghi
Chapter Four: Heresy in Lawrence Durrell's Heraldic Universe
Paul Lorenz
Chapter Five: A "Most Anomalous" Island: Lawrence Durrell's Writings on Patmos
Athanasios Dimakis
Chapter Six: Life in the Tomb: Lawrence Durrell's Heterotopia on the Island of Rhodes
Athena Hadji
Chapter Seven: Personalist Heterotopias: Henry Miller's Street and Lawrence Durrell's Hotel
Isabelle Keller-Privat
Chapter Eight: Postmodern Gothic: Traveling Gothic Motifs in The Avignon Quintet
Pamela J. Francis
Chapter Nine: Durrell's Buddhist Heterotopias: Mount Vulture and Angkor Wat
Fiona Tomkinson
Chapter Ten: Heterotopia and Other Places: Displacing Expectations of Theme and Style in Durrell's Travel Books
James M. Clawson
